For the 2026 school year, there are 2 private schools serving 522 students in 71118, LA (there are , serving 4,167 public students). 11% of all K-12 students in 71118, LA are educated in private schools (compared to the LA state average of 15%).
The average acceptance rate is 99%, which is higher than the Louisiana private school average acceptance rate of 85%.
100% of private schools in 71118, LA are religiously affiliated (most commonly Christian and Pentecostal).
